How The Truth About Naples Probate Fees You Need to Know Actually Works

To understand the truth, it helps to look at the basic mechanics of the process. Probate is the legal system for validating a will and distributing assets. In Naples, as in other Florida locations, this process is overseen by the local court system. The fees are not arbitrary; they follow a specific schedule. Common costs include court filing fees, costs for publishing legal notices, and payments for a personal representative. If a will is present, the process might be smoother, but it still requires court approval. When someone dies without a will, the process can become more complex and time-consuming. These factors directly influence the total amount an estate will pay. It is essentially the administrative price of transferring ownership legally and correctly.

What Fees Are Typically Involved in The Truth About Naples Probate Fees You Need to Know?

The specific costs can vary based on the estate's complexity and value. Generally, fees are categorized into fixed amounts and percentage-based charges. The court filing fee is a set amount required to open the probate case. Notice publication fees cover the cost of alerting creditors and potential heirs. The personal representative, who manages the estate, may receive a fee calculated as a percentage of the estate's value. This structure is designed to compensate their time and effort. Appraisal fees for property and other assets are also common. For example, a modest home might incur lower total costs than a large estate with multiple properties. Understanding this breakdown helps set realistic expectations.

Common Questions People Have About The Truth About Naples Probate Fees You Need to Know

Many people wonder if avoiding probate is possible to save money. The short answer is that it is often achievable through careful planning. Tools like payable-on-death bank accounts and transfer-on-death deeds can bypass the court process. Revocable living trusts are another popular method for avoiding probate entirely. These strategies can save time and money for the heirs. However, they require action before someone passes away. It’s about organizing affairs in advance. Another frequent question involves the role of a lawyer. While Florida law allows for informal probate without an attorney, the process is intricate. A lawyer can help ensure compliance and prevent costly mistakes. Professional guidance often pays for itself in the long run.

Things People Often Misunderstand About The Truth About Naples Probate Fees You Need to Know

One of the biggest myths is that probate is always slow and expensive. While it can be, careful planning and straightforward cases can be quite efficient. Another misunderstanding is that the process is only for the wealthy. In reality, probate applies to any estate that does not have a designated beneficiary or trust. People also sometimes believe that a will alone avoids probate. Unfortunately, a will is actually a instruction manual for probate, not a way to avoid it.
